Shirin Akhter joins as MD of Karmasangsthan Bank
  Date : 19-04-2024

Press Release: The Government of the People`s Republic of Bangladesh appointed Shirin Akhter as Managing Director of Karmasangsthan Bank on contractual basis for a period of 2 (two) years then she joined Karmasangsthan Bank on 20 December 2021. She retired from the post of Managing Director of Bangladesh Krishi Bank on 14 December 2021. After completion of post graduate degree with Honours in Political Science from DhakaUniversity, she started her career as Senior Officer in Agrani Bank through BRC in 1988. During her tenure at Agrani Bank, she performed her duties as Branch Manager, Head of Division, CFO and also Circle Heads of Faridpur, Sylhet, Dhaka Circle-2 and Mymensingh Division. In her career, she earned MBA, LLB and DAIBB degree. She was born in a reputed muslim family of Charbhadrasan Upazilla in Faridpur District. In personal life, she is the eldest daughter of late Ayesha Rahman who was the founder General Secretary of Bangladesh Mohila Awami League, Mohammadpur thana of Dhaka and Late Khalilur Rahman, former Assistant Director Of Bangladesh Bank. She is the grandson’s wife of Dr. Muhammad Shahidullah, a renowned linguist and great-granddaughter of famous Hekimi physician of the subcontinent Hekim Habibur Rahman Akhunjada. She is blessed with a son.
